BJP District President Komal Singh Rajput Targets Congress Over Vande Mataram Row, Hails ₹500-Crore AI Mission in Chhattisgarh

BJP Rajnandgaon district president Komal Singh Rajput criticised Congress over its reported decision to restrict Vande Mataram to its first two stanzas at party platforms, accusing the party of placing its CWC decision above the law. In a separate statement, Rajput welcomed Chhattisgarh Cabinet approval of the ₹500-crore State AI Mission, which will be implemented over five years and includes 100 AI data labs, five Centres of Excellence, support for 300+ AI startups and specialised AI training for 6 lakh students and 1.5 lakh government employees.

Dr Raman Singh Secures ₹10.38 Crore for Infrastructure Push in Rajnandgaon Constituency

Dr Raman Singh has secured ₹10.38 crore under the Infrastructure and Environment Cess Fund for development works in Rajnandgaon constituency for FY 2025–26. The approved projects include CC roads, community halls, sanitation facilities, high-mast lights and public infrastructure across dozens of villages.

Civic Negligence at Mohara Water Plant Leaves Rajnandgaon Residents Drinking Contaminated Water

Severe water mismanagement at the Mohara Water Treatment Plant in Rajnandgaon has triggered public outrage, as residents are forced to consume muddy and untreated water. Leader of Opposition in the Municipal Corporation, Santosh Pille, exposed the critical shortage of alum, alleging deep administrative apathy under BJP’s civic leadership.
